Company Description
Studio19 is a digital marketing agency specializing in automotive dealerships, providing measurable results from ad spend by combining AI-driven automation with hands-on expertise. We optimize Google and Facebook advertising campaigns with detailed tracking systems, giving dealers full visibility into ad performance and real business outcomes. Our approach uses targeted search campaigns based on historical data and strategic keyword bidding to enhance conversion rates. Unlike other agencies, Studio19 delivers manual creative optimizations for Facebook ads alongside AI-guided strategies to connect ad performance directly to vehicle sales, repair orders, and revenue, offering transparent, accountable, full-funnel marketing solutions.
Role Description
This is a full-time remote role for a Social Media Manager. The Social Media Manager will be responsible for developing and executing social media strategies, creating engaging content, optimizing social media accounts, and managing daily social media activities. The role involves collaborating with the marketing team to drive brand awareness and engagement, monitoring social media trends, and analyzing performance metrics to adjust strategies for maximum effectiveness. Additionally, the Social Media Manager will communicate with followers, respond to queries promptly, and oversee the social media presence of automotive dealer clients.
Compensation
Base salary starting at $60,000, with higher offers considered for candidates with relevant experience and strong qualifications. Additional performance-based bonuses may be available.
